How would the improved transport and communication system benefit the Indian later?
Advertisements
Solution
The transport and communication system, however, would ultimately benefit Indians in unexpected ways. Besides stimulating trade and commerce it would bring the people of India closer to one another and infuse in them a sense of unity and nationalism a development that would have far-reaching effects on India’s future.
